Performance Review - In H1 2025, the company reported revenue of 651 million y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 27.54%, and a net profit attributable to shareholders of 79 million yuan, down 9.88% year-on-year. The net profit excluding non-recurring items was 57 million yuan, a decline of 36.05% year-on-year. In Q2 2025, revenue reached 461 million y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 2.27% but a quarter-on-quarter increase of 141.36%. The net profit attributable to shareholders was 50 million yuan, up 4.96% year-on-year and 74.02% quarter-on-quarter. The net profit excluding non-recurring items was 35 million yuan, down 33.20% year-on-year but up 63.98% quarter-on-quarter [1]. Microinverter & Energy Communication Device Sales - In H1 2025, the company generated revenue of 358 million yuan from microinverters and energy communication devices, a year-on-year decline of 42.08%, primarily due to a decrease in new installations in traditional overseas photovoltaic markets. The shipment volume for H1 2025 was approximately 340,000 units, down 40.04% year-on-year, with Q2 2025 shipments at about 190,000 units, reflecting a quarter-on-quarter increase of 26.67%. This increase was attributed to the company's strategy of offering slight discounts to ensure growth in shipment volume [2]. Energy Storage Business Growth - The company's energy storage business maintained a high growth rate in H1 2025, becoming a significant driver of revenue growth. The revenue from industrial and commercial storage systems was 190 million yuan, up 6.43% year-on-year, while household storage product revenue was 20 million yuan, an increase of 34.11% year-on-year, benefiting from the global demand for commercial and industrial energy storage and the company's channel expansion. However, revenue from smart control circuit breakers was 58 million yuan, down 24.24% year-on-year, likely impacted by market demand structure adjustments and intensified industry competition [3]. Cost Management and Cash Position - The company's expense ratio for H1 2025 was 10.51%, a decrease of 6.5 percentage points compared to 2024. In Q2 2025, the expense ratio was 5.5%, reflecting a quarter-on-quarter decrease of 17.2 percentage points, mainly due to increased revenue and foreign exchange gains. As of H1 2025, the company had cash and cash equivalents of 1.38 billion yuan and trading financial assets of 530 million yuan, totaling nearly 2 billion yuan in cash, which is sufficient to support further expansion in new businesses such as energy storage [4]. Profit Forecast and Investment Recommendation - Considering industry competition, the company has revised its net profit forecasts for 2025-2027 to 195 million yuan, 249 million yuan, and 327 million yuan, respectively. The previous estimates for 2025-2026 were 360 million yuan and 450 million yuan. The current stock price corresponds to price-to-earnings ratios of 47.8, 37.5, and 28.5 times for the respective years. Given the company's position as a leading microinverter manufacturer and the expected continued growth in shipments post-inventory digestion, along with the energy storage business entering a phase of increased volume, a "buy" rating is maintained [5].
